View Lists
View Lists allow the values of a set of parameters to
be accessed at the same time. View lists are available
for the resource and transducer blocks, and the
function blocks.
Resource Block—tables 5-6 through 5-9
Transducer Block—tables 5-14 through 5-20
AO Function Block—tables 5-25 through 5-28
PID Function Block—tables 5-32 through 5-35
IS Function Block—tables 5-40 through 5-43
OS Function Block—tables 5-48 through 5-51
AI Function Block—tables 5-57 through 5-60
MAI Function Block—tables 5-64 through 5-67
DO Function Block—tables 5-72 through 5-75
DI Function Block—tables 5-81 through 5-84
Note
Views Lists are used by hosts for
efficient monitoring of multiple
parameters. Normally you will not be
aware of view list usage, as they are
hidden by the host software.
Resource Block
This section contains information on the DVC6000f
Series digital valve controller resource block. The
resource block defines the physical resources of the
device. The resource block also handles functionality
that is common across multiple blocks. The block has
no linkable inputs or outputs.

Strategy
Strategy (STRATEGY [3]) permits strategic grouping
of blocks so the operator can identify where the block
is located. The blocks may be grouped by plant area,
plant equipment, etc. Enter a value between 0 and
65535 in the Strategy field.
Tag Description
The Tag Description (TAG_DESC [2]) is unique
description of each block within the digital valve
controller, used to describe the intended application
for the block. Follow the prompts on the Field
Communicator to enter an up to 32 character
description for the block in the Tag Description field.
(This parameter is read/write.)

Factory Serial Number
The Factory Serial Number (FACTORY_SN [50]) is
the instrument serial number set at the factory.
Field Serial Number
The Field Serial Number (FIELD_SN [51]) is the serial
number of the valve and actuator on which the
instrument is mounted.
Manf ID
Manufacturer Identification (MANUFAC_ID [10])
identifies the manufacturer of the instrument. It is used
by the host system to locate the DD file for the device.
For Fisher the Manf ID is 0x5100.
Device Type
Device Type (DEV_TYPE [11]) identifies the type of
device. It is used by the host system to locate the DD
file for the device. For a DVC6000f digital valve
controller with Standard Control the device type is
0x4601.
